Understanding the Parramatta Search Landscape
The way people search for businesses in Parramatta differs significantly from broader, national searches. A key characteristic is the prevalence of “on-the-go” searches. Commuters, shoppers, and residents frequently use mobile devices to find businesses “near me” or within specific suburbs. This mobile-first behaviour underscores the critical importance of mobile-friendliness in any local SEO strategy. According to sources, people in Parramatta often search while commuting, walking, or simply being out and about. This means your website must load quickly, display correctly on smaller screens, and offer convenient features like click-to-call buttons, particularly for service-based businesses. Google prioritizes mobile-optimized sites in local search results, directly impacting your visibility.
Beyond mobile, the local search ecosystem in Parramatta is heavily influenced by Google Maps and Google Business Profile (GBP). A well-optimized GBP listing is often the first impression a potential customer has of your business. It’s the virtual storefront that appears in map packs and local search results, providing essential information like your address, phone number, opening hours, and customer reviews.
The Core Pillars of Parramatta Local SEO
Effective local SEO in Parramatta rests on three fundamental pillars: Technical SEO, On-Page SEO, and Off-Page SEO. Each element plays a crucial role in signaling to search engines that your business is relevant and trustworthy for local searches.
Technical SEO: This focuses on ensuring search engines can easily crawl, index, and understand your website. Key aspects include site speed, mobile-friendliness, a clear site structure, and the implementation of schema markup. Technical issues can hinder your rankings, even with excellent content and strong backlinks.
On-Page SEO: This involves optimizing individual web pages to rank for specific keywords. This includes keyword research, optimizing title tags and meta descriptions, creating high-quality content, and ensuring internal linking. Content should be relevant to the Parramatta market and address the specific needs of local customers.
Off-Page SEO: This encompasses activities conducted outside your website to build authority and trust. The most significant component is link building – acquiring backlinks from reputable websites. Local citations (mentions of your business name, address, and phone number on other websites) are also crucial for establishing local relevance.
Optimizing Your Google Business Profile (GBP)
Your Google Business Profile is arguably the most important asset for local SEO in Parramatta. A complete and optimized GBP listing can significantly boost your visibility in local search results and Google Maps. Here’s a breakdown of key optimization strategies:
- Claim and Verify: Ensure you’ve claimed and verified your GBP listing.
- Complete All Sections: Fill out every section of your profile with accurate and detailed information.
- Choose Relevant Categories: Select the most relevant categories for your business.
- High-Quality Photos: Upload high-resolution photos of your business, products, and team.
- Regular Posts: Publish regular posts to share updates, promotions, and events.
- Manage Reviews: Actively respond to both positive and negative reviews.
- Utilize Questions & Answers: Monitor and answer questions asked by potential customers.

The Power of Local Citations and Backlinks
Local Citations: These are online mentions of your business name, address, and phone number (NAP) on other websites. Consistent NAP information across the web is crucial for building trust with search engines. Directories like Yelp, Yellow Pages, and industry-specific websites are excellent sources for local citations.
Backlinks: These are links from other websites to your website. Backlinks are a strong signal of authority and trust. Focus on acquiring backlinks from reputable websites in Parramatta and surrounding areas. Strategies include:
- Local Sponsorships: Sponsor local events or organizations.
- Community Involvement: Participate in local community initiatives.
- Guest Blogging: Write guest posts for local blogs and websites.
- Broken Link Building: Identify broken links on local websites and offer your content as a replacement.
Measuring Your Local SEO Performance
Tracking your progress is essential for refining your local SEO strategy. Key metrics to monitor include:
- Keyword Rankings: Track your rankings for relevant keywords in Parramatta.
- Website Traffic: Monitor organic traffic from local searches.
- Google Business Profile Insights: Analyze your GBP performance, including views, clicks, and calls.
- Lead Generation: Track the number of leads generated from local SEO efforts.
- Conversion Rates: Monitor the percentage of website visitors who convert into customers.
Here's a comparison of tools commonly used for tracking local SEO performance:
| Tool | Features |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Google Analytics | Website traffic, user behavior, conversion tracking | Free |
| Google Search Console | Keyword rankings, indexing status, crawl errors | Free |
| SEMrush | Keyword research, competitor analysis, rank tracking, site audit | Paid |
| BrightLocal | Local citation building, rank tracking, GBP management | Paid |
| Ubersuggest | Keyword research, competitor analysis, content ideas | Freemium/Paid |
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Several common mistakes can derail your local SEO efforts in Parramatta:
- Inconsistent NAP Information: Ensure your business name, address, and phone number are consistent across all online platforms.
- Neglecting Mobile Optimization: A non-mobile-friendly website will severely limit your reach.
- Ignoring Google Business Profile: An incomplete or unoptimized GBP listing is a missed opportunity.
- Spammy Link Building: Avoid acquiring backlinks from low-quality or irrelevant websites.
- Lack of Patience: Local SEO takes time and consistent effort. Don’t expect overnight results.
